Output 8ad91a13b04aef72f29ee953e9ae651398766221421fe2e430ec9beae6b44bed:0

value
68434921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d2e9c63c105c31b84d4d6afde7a75bd7e48647 OP_EQUAL
address
MTDBUQoKdAYf8kC4AZFKtXjJj3YxyMvMVG
transaction
8ad91a13b04aef72f29ee953e9ae651398766221421fe2e430ec9beae6b44bed
spent
true